What is 6FF?

6FF is a complex chemical compound recognized as a ligand. More specifically, it is defined as 5-[4-(2-fluorophenyl)-5-oxo-4,5-dihydro-1H-1,2,4-triazol-3-yl]-2,4-dihydroxy-N-methyl-N-propylbenzene-1-sulfonamide. This compound plays a vital role in biochemistry and molecular interactions by binding to proteins and other macromolecules, thereby influencing their behavior and function. Ligands like 6FF are crucial in various applications, including drug design and molecular biology, owing to their ability to modulate binding sites on proteins and receptors.

Properties of 6FF

Chemical Composition

6FF comprises various chemical groups, including triazole, hydroxybenzene, and sulfonamide functionalities, each contributing to its unique profile. Understanding its chemical composition reveals how it can interact with biological targets. The relevance of such interactions cannot be overstated, as they determine 6FF’s utility in applications ranging from drug development to biochemical assay design.
